18 Jan, Fri 7:59AM | Du Faurs Creek Canyon | ||||
Grade:5/6 | Length | 12km | Sydney Branch | ||
Yuri B. | |||||
(Updated Details) A day of wading, swimming and liloing through Du Faurs Creek Canyon. Start and finish at Mount Wilson. Must be able to swim well. Wet suit recommended. Bring helmet and dry bags. About 12k. Location: Blue Mountains National Park Map: Mount Wilson 89301N and Wollangambe 89312S View |

19 Jan, Sat 7:33AM | Illawarra Escarpment Traverse | ||||
Grade:3/6 | Length | 18km | 250m | Sydney Branch | |
Mark G. | |||||
If you're after superlative views, wonderful sections of rainforest and colourful flowering heathlands then this walk from Stanwell Park Station to Austinmer Station via the Wodi Wodi, Bullock and Escarpment Tracks should be high on your priority. Add a magnificent historic viaduct and a top lunch spot at Sublime Point will make this a day walk to remember. The Wodi Wodi Track can be slippery in parts after rain. Location: Stanwell Park Map: Appin 90291S and Bulli 90292N Limit: 15. Best Walk: Illawarra Escarpment Traverse View |

23 Jan, Wed 8:00AM | Clatterteeth Canyon | ||||
Grade:4/6 | Length | 8km | 250m | Sydney Branch | |
Graham C. | |||||
Clatterteeth Canyon with side trip up Lower Bell Canyon and exit via Wollongambe Canyon. Entry via Joes Canyon, Clatterteeth Canyon, side trip up Bell and exit via Wollongambe Canyon. The side trip up Bell is of classic canyon beauty. Wetsuits, lilos, volleys/similar. Usual scrambling. One fairly easy blockup to negotiate. 8k, 250m desc/asc carrying wet gear uphill with a steepish climb out. Slippery rocks, deep cold water. Some rough scrub. Location: Blue Mountains National Park Map: Wollangambe 89312S Limit: 8. View |

25 Jan, Fri 7:07AM | Bowens Creek South Canyon (non abseiling route) | ||||
Grade:5/6 | Length | 8km | Sydney Branch | ||
Yuri B. | |||||
(Updated Details) A beautiful canyon. We’ll enter via Corkscrew Canyon in order to get into our canyon without abseiling. Plenty of rock hopping and scrambling and some narrow ledges to negotiate. Several wades and/or short swims. An interesting exit with a couple of scrambles - rope may be used. Some exposure at the exit and in the canyon. Bring your helmets and dry bags. Wetsuits recommended. About 8k. 5M, S223E; Canyon Grade 2. Location: Blue Mountains National Park Map: Mount Wilson 89301N View |

5 Feb, Tue 9:30AM | Fitzroy Falls West & East Rim Tracks | ||||
Grade:3/6 | Length | 8km | 300m | Southern Highlands Branch | |
Mike M | |||||
Fitzroy Falls West Rim and East Rim Tracks provide spectacular views of the main falls, Twin Falls, the Grotto and the valley between the two tracks. The vegetation is very different on each of the tracks. Lunch will be at an off-track lookout in the vicinity of a plane crash beyond Renown Lookout. Fenced and unfenced cliffs. Rough track, steep sections, slippery rocks. Off-track to get to crash site. Location: Morton NP Map: Bundanoon 89281S Limit: 20. View |
